These three residues form a hydrogen bonding network that allows deprotonation of ser195 during the reaction. Pymol uses the merck molecular force field mmff, which accurately accommodates a variety of atom types and functional groups. I have a query i completed docking with auto dock vina in windows machine. I know i can can find the hydrogen bond interactions between a selection and surrounding residues within a certain radius. Ligand docking and binding site analysis with pymol and. In order to decrease the steep learning curve assocd. Using pymol to explore the effects of ph on noncovalent. Electrostatic clashes donordonor or acceptoracceptor are shown in red. Using pymol, i can show hydrogen bonds using action find polar contacts. Pymol was created in an efficient but highly pragmatic manner, with heavy emphasis on delivering powerful features to end users.
If you want to perform more complicated bonding then these commands can be use. I want a pymol script to automatically draw bonds for a given structure, e. In answer to your question 2, there are two reasons why stick with the term polar contacts instead of hydrogen bonds. I dont know how to make a hydrogen bond between two residues. Visualizing hydrogen bonds in pymol chemistry with computers. To know more about different mode please visit pymolwiki now you can see hydrogen bonding with distances between bonding residues. Click the color button for hydrogen bonds and choose a new color in the color selector. Therefore, there is need for introduction of easily understandable molecular descriptors. Addh then uses the atom types to determine the number of hydrogens to be added and their positions. So, i find the way to draw a bond between to atoms, for example.
How can pymol be exploited for seeing ligandprotein interactions. For example, you can create dashed lines a good way to show hydrogen bonds between oxygens and nearby amide hydrogens in the alphahelix by using a command dist helix and name o, helix and name h and neighbor name n, 2. Pymol is a usersponsored molecular visualization system on an opensource foundation, maintained and distributed by schrodinger. The underlying function is based on the different atom types, such as hydrogen bond acceptor and donor atoms, and thus it is required to have hydrogen atoms present in the structure. Good hydrogen bonds as determined by pymol are shown in yellow. Pymol is there a way to count hydrogen bond interactions. Oxygen atoms are highlighted in red and numbered on the basis of adjoining. Unofficial windows binaries for python extension packages download pymol 1. Now you can see hydrogen bonding with distances between bonding residues. Pymol s moviemaking capability smoothly transitions from scene to scene so that the audience continues to have a frame of reference during perspective changes. This produces the contacts, but i want to show them clearly by only showing residues which have these contacts and nothing else currently, the view is very unclear due to the rest of the protein. Pymol has an extensive help system, and documentation can be found by typing help command for many commands.
These settings can be changed before running the detection process dist command mode2 or via the menus. Make a copy of in the gray box under the the code, and then paste it into a text file. This video is about how to display hydrogen bonds in a protein within the protein and to ligands and how to change the cutoff values for. Example proteinligand interfaceill show you how to display hydrogen bond between protein and ligand. Download script by using the script called color h, you can colorcode by hydrophobicity. Optionally residues within the binding site can be defined to be flexible during docking. So the bottom line is that pymol merely offers up putative polar contacts and leaves it to the user to determine whether or not the interactions present are in fact hydrogen bonds, salt bridges, polar interactions, or merely artifacts of incorrect assignments i. I want to select all residues that have the hydrogen bonds that i found. Aug 02, 2015 in the scheduled pymol lab period, you will have to create a pymol image based on the the procedure in this video. Pymol and openbabel based protein atomic interaction calculator. Chimera uses atom and residue names, or if these are not standard, atomic coordinates, to determine connectivity and atom types. You will need to change this into a solid cylinder for building a physical protein model using 3d printing. In the present work, we present a new pymol plugin, pydescriptor, which has capacity to calculate 11,145 easily understandable molecular descriptors. Depending upon the local context, helix and strand.
Using hbond and positional constraints schrodinger. Note that bonds can be edited to be delocalized using unbond and bond. The size and location of this binding site is visualized in pymol and can be adjusted interactively. View 3d molecular structures render figures artistically. According to autodock result, the docking pose shows an intermolecular energy of. Subsequently, the necessary files for the receptor definition are generated automatically. May 24, 2017 students explore these concepts by examining the primary and tertiary structures of immunoglobulin g igg and protein a. It is a new cheminformatics tool which transforms a variety of structural features and local environment. Pymol can produce highquality graphics, on par with molscript, without needing to manually edit text files. Note that the hydrogen bond geometric criteria used in pymol was designed to emulate that used by dssp. A dehydron is a protein backbone hydrogen bond incompletely shielded. How to display hydrogen bonds in the free icmbrowser see.
Action find polar contacts select from menu helix is shown in the figure below. Pymol incentive product created for the exclusive use of pymol subscribers who sponsor the effort financially. It enables the 3d visualization of all kinds of proteins and molecules, together with their related trajectories and surfaces. What is the hoc bond angle for the backbone hydrogen bond between residues l73 and f21. In the plugin, the box center can by defined either by providing explicit coordinates or, more user friendly, by defining a pymol selection e. It is a freeware, you can download it from the link attached below. A beginners guide to molecular visualization using pymol. In the scheduled pymol lab period, you will have to create a pymol image based on the the procedure in this video.
Pymol is a powerful and comprehensive molecular visualization product for rendering and animating 3d molecular structures. The hbonds command displays only backbonetobackbone hydrogen bonds in regions of defined secondary structure, and watsoncrick internucleotide bonds in dna double helix. Both autodock and vina use rectangular boxes for the definition of the binding site. Importance of hydrogen bond contacts between the n protein. The hydrogen bond is not present there, i know using prediction that beta turn is forming at a specific location. A top ranking cluster, b second, most populated cluster. Jan 10, 2011 pymol dist name, cha, chb, mode2 executive. I wanted to manually make the hydrogen between two residues. Expediency has almost always taken precedence over elegance, and. Movies can be programmed to smooth data, illustrate hydrogen bond ephemerality, and even simulate slow motion. The nucleophilic alkoxide anion then attacks the carbonyl carbon in the peptide bond. Note that there is a minor technical hiccup with sdfiles which are loaded by default as immutable discrete objects. The command line allows you to type in commands that can accomplish almost any of pymol s functions.
Students explore these concepts by examining the primary and tertiary structures of immunoglobulin g igg and protein a. Please see the web site for information on supporting it. Download it to your computer and run it from there run command or file run. Hydrogen bonds are classified as ionic interactions baker and hubbard, 1984. Intermezzo is a python package and pymol plugin for calculating and visualising interatomic interactions of various types, such as hydrogen bonds and aromatic contacts. Analysis using pymol indicated that these mutations would disrupt hydrogen bond formation between each amino acid and the rna. There is also a command called valence examples for the settings. Turning on the valence setting will enable the display of double bonds. Usage dss selection, state argument selection string.
Pymol molecular graphics system pymol hydrogen bond. Students use pymol, an open source molecular visualization application, to 1 identify hydrogen bonds and salt bridges between and within the proteins at physiological ph and 2 apply their knowledge of phpk a to. Pymol is one of the most used molecular visualization software in both chemistry and biology. Desktop molecular graphics pymol 1 from the preface of the users guide.
Bond works fine but the bond is no longer there once i reopen the file that what i mean by stable. The fourth in a series of videos for beginners of pymol. Large buttons allow the user to download a pymol session file containing the structure and interactions, and tabulated results files including the results from atomtyping and interaction detection. Make sure that you can download pdb files from the data bank and edit the file. I would like to find a way to retrieve the actual count of those interactions per residue. Im intending on running this software for pdb files. The%proteindatabank,%pdb% % inthis%sectionyouwillbe%introducedtotheproteindata%bank,pdb. I used the two functions from pymol bond and fuse to form this bond. Geometric criteria of hydrogen bonds in proteins and. Rasmol and chime have no builtin mechanism to locate and display other types of hydrogen bonds, such as any involving sidechains, interchain hbonds.
In this post, a small script is presented to visualize all possible h bonds in a molecule. Aug 18, 2016 the underlying function is based on the different atom types, such as hydrogen bond acceptor and donor atoms, and thus it is required to have hydrogen atoms present in the structure. They are encoded based on the concept of structural interaction fingerprints sift, first introduced by deng et al. Restructuring the crystalline cellulose hydrogen bond network. How can i add a hydrogen bond in a given structure. Introduction about this booklet welcome this is a followalong guide for the introduction to pymol classroom tutorial taught by delano scienti. In the case of a226 where the hydrogen bond is contributed from the protein backbone, we substituted glycine, which could be considered as a control for altering protein structure rather than a test for disrupting a.
In order to study the network structure of proteins, im looking for software that can predict the existence of hydrogen bonds in proteins from pdb data. The default display for hydrogen bonds is a dashed line. Select residues pymol bond pk1, pk2 or pymol fuse pk1, pk2. Measurement of bond distances and angles is straightforward in pymol. How might i visualize interaction hydrogen bonds between. How can i change the color of hydrogen bonds so as to be. Pymol molecular graphics system pymol hbond display. Display of hydrogen bond display of hydrogen bond is simple. If your structure file doesnt contain hydrogen atoms already, you can add them directly in pymol as shown in the image below. Adding hydrogen bonds see displaying biochemical properties.
Apr 18, 2020 pymol is a comprehensive and powerful application that allows you to design and then visualize molecular structures. Hydrogens are usually too small to see by crystallography, so pymol must calculate the theoretical positions. Adding hydrogen bonds, disulfide bonds, and struts in jmol. A c and cellulose iii i d f crystalline allomorphs in crosssectionala,d,equatorialb,e,andaxialc,fviews. A collection of pymol plugins to visualize atomic bonds. How to view show enzyme drug interactions other than. Download script by using the script called interfaceresidues, you can select interface residues. One of the bets qualities of pymol is the ability to incorporate different capabilities such as visualizing hydrogen bonds.
I want to visualize interaction hydrogen bonds between ligand and protein after docking with auto dock vina. Browse to the location of the downloaded file and open it. We will be using pcs running linux for this exercise, but you should be able to do all of the same things on windows or mac osx. I can do this manually by the bond command, but need to know the identifiers of the atoms. Therefore, unlike a covalent bond, hydrogen bonds are characterized not by specific bond lengths and angles, but by using broader ranges of values.
You can change the color in the interactions toggle which is available at the bottom right of maestro in the status bar. It covers the basics of pymol for medicinal chemists and other industrial scientists, including visualization of protein. Whenever an atom or bond has been picked, a number of atom selections are automatically defined as described in the following table. Note that there is a minor technical hiccup with sdfiles which are. Apr 11, 2018 you can change the color in the interactions toggle which is available at the bottom right of maestro in the status bar. To know more about different mode please visit pymolwiki. Hello pymolers, i am displaying hydrogen bonds using. Pymol molecular graphics system pymol is there a way to. Provides a scriptable interface to pymol, a few basic commands for structure information, and an executable for determining hydrogen bond characteristics as would be useful to those doing hydrogen exchange experiments.
1215 708 587 1241 816 504 813 614 138 1200 345 1148 467 1267 1321 672 139 130 1301 1310 1447 1358 68 446 500 354 878 353